Special to ColumbiaMagazine.com

The Adair County Lady Indians and Indians will host Bardstown in the final home game of the season tonight, Tuesday, February 18, 2014, at Adair County High School Gym, 526 Indian Drive, Columbia, KY, with the Lady Indians stating at 5:30pmCT, and the Indian Varsity Boys game at around 7:15pmCT.


Senior recognition will take place between games.

The Tigers are ranked number 2 in the region with their only loss coming at the hands of top ranked E-town Friday night, February 14, 2014, by one point.

Twelve seniors will be recognized tonight. Senior cheerleaders are Angel Burton, Ashley Perkins, and Rachel Stephens. Senior girl's basketball players are Kassidi Taylor, Emily Peck, and Sammy Jo Kemp. Senior members of the boy's team are Ty Bennett, Jake Hixson, B.J. Steinhilber, Marshall Shelley, Kyle Burton, and Matt Fudge.
